Congrats to Arturo Montes and Jeremy Noland who have begun their Turbine Transition Training at Guidance Aviation. The Bell 206 will be busy this week as thirteen students enrolled in Yavapai College's Professional Pilot Degree Program are taking part in the turbine training.

Guidance Aviation was the first FAA Approved Part 141 high altitude helicopter flight training facility in the U.S. The program is VA Chapter 33 benefits approved for eligible U.S. Military Veterans through our collegiate partner program. Students may acquire their Associate of Applied Science (AAS) degree, Professional Pilot, Aviation Technology. Courses include advanced turbine training, long line operations, Part 135 tour operations, and night vision goggles (NVG).
